Session beer is a beer that was produced to consume during working hours. Generations ago, the day would be broken up into two work periods, with a lengthy break in-between the two work periods. During this break period the workers would have a beer, or two. So a beer was produced to drink during these break sessions; they are called session beers. They are generally a good tasting IPA without the kicked up hops and high alcohol content.
